Judgment text excerpt
The Supreme Court upheld the findings of the Industrial Court under Section 28 of the Maharashtra Recognition of Trade Unions and Prevention of Unfair Labour Practices Act, 1971, confirming that the appellant-Company engaged in unfair labour practices as per Item Nos. 6 and 9 of Schedule IV. The Court emphasized that the rotational employment system employed by the Company was a tactic to deny workers their rights to permanency despite the availability of work of a permanent nature. The appeals by the Company were dismissed, affirming the Industrial Court's award.
